Composite polyamide membrane with increased carboxylic acid functionality |
摘要 |
A thin film composite membrane including a porous support and a thin film polyamide layer characterized by having a dissociated carboxylate content of at least 0.45 moles/kg at pH 9.5 and a method for making a composite polyamide applying a polar solution comprising a polyfunctional amine monomer and a non-polar solution comprising a polyfunctional amine-reactive monomer to a surface of the porous support and interfacially polymerizing the monomers to form a thin film polyamide layer, wherein the method is characterized by the non-polar solution comprising at least 0.025 wt % of an acid compound including at least one carboxylic acid moiety and at least one amine-reactive moiety selected from acyl halide and anhydride. |

主权项 |
1. A thin film composite polyamide membrane comprising a porous support and a thin film polyamide layer characterized by having a dissociated carboxylate content of 0.45 moles/kg to 0.556 moles/kg at pH 9.5, and wherein the composite polyamide membrane has a NaCl Passage of less than 1% when tested using an aqueous salt solution (2000 ppm NaCl) at 150 psi, pH 8 and 25° C. |
